Darrington Fire District 24 is comprised of two fire stations. The district’s service area is approximately 20 square miles with an estimated population of over 3,500 residents. The service area includes the Town of Darrington, Sauk-Suiattle Tribe, Snohomish County Fire District 24, and Skagit County Fire District 18.
Darrington Fire District 24 is committed to ensuring that when the need arises, our personnel are trained, dedicated, and professional with well-resourced apparatus equipped with lifesaving equipment. In 2016, Darrington Fire District 24 responded to 532 incidents, our busiest year yet! 2017 is on track to being busier than 2016. Like most fire departments, most of our calls were medical emergencies.
